Common Questions About Where to Buy Stock
Q: How safe is storing stocks electronically?
Modern platforms use multi-layered security, including encryption and compliance with SEC and FINRA regulations, ensuring user assets remain protected from unauthorized access and fraud.
Q: Do I need expertise to start buying stock?
Not at all. Most trading interfaces offer educational guides and simulated environments that demystify investing, letting users learn by doing in low-risk spaces before committing real funds.
Q: Can I invest small amounts?
Yes. Many brokers and digital platforms now support fractional shares and low minimum investment thresholds, democratizing access for new or part-time investors focused on steady growth.
Q: What role does mobile play in buying stocks today?
Mobile applications dominate engagement—offering instant access, intuitive design, and push notifications that keep users informed and engaged, ideal for on-the-go decision making.
